Package mgui.datasources
Interface DataSourceItem
- All Superinterfaces:
CleanableObject
,IconObject
,InterfaceObject
,NamedObject
,SQLObject
,TreeObject
,XMLObject
public interface DataSourceItem extends SQLObject, InterfaceObject, IconObject, XMLObject
An item (i.e., table or query) in a
DataSource
.- Since:
- 1.0
- Version:
- 1.0
- Author:
- Andrew Reid
-
Nested Class Summary
Nested classes/interfaces inherited from interface mgui.interfaces.xml.XMLObject
XMLObject.XMLEncoding, XMLObject.XMLType
-
Method Summary
Modifier and Type Method Description DataSource
getDataSource()
boolean
hasSortedFields()
void
setDataSource(DataSource source)
Methods inherited from interface mgui.interfaces.util.CleanableObject
clean
Methods inherited from interface mgui.resources.icons.IconObject
getObjectIcon
Methods inherited from interface mgui.interfaces.InterfaceObject
destroy, isDestroyed
Methods inherited from interface mgui.interfaces.NamedObject
getName, setName
Methods inherited from interface mgui.datasources.SQLObject
getSQLStatement, getSQLStatement
Methods inherited from interface mgui.interfaces.trees.TreeObject
getTreeLabel, issueTreeNode, setTreeNode
Methods inherited from interface mgui.interfaces.xml.XMLObject
getDTD, getLocalName, getShortXML, getXML, getXML, getXMLSchema, handleXMLElementEnd, handleXMLElementStart, handleXMLString, writeXML, writeXML, writeXML
-
Method Details
-
setDataSource
-
getDataSource
DataSource getDataSource() -
hasSortedFields
boolean hasSortedFields()
-